Ever since I built this new pc it has this strange crash where all of the peripherals lose power. (monitor loses signal) but all of the internal LEDs, fans... are still working. The power button on the case will not work after the crash and Im required to flip the PSU switch and restart. I cant find any error codes but all it has is "the system shut down unexpectedly" I will get a spec list and edit this

MoBo: Gigabyte b650m DS3H
CPU: Ryzen 5 7600x
RAM: Crucial 16g ddr5 4800 (pc5 38400)
PSU : Phanteks Revolt 750
GPU: MSI Ventus 1650

Any other specs you need, Ill lookup

I've had a lot of issues with the BIOS on my Gigabyte board (I've got the gaming X AX, which is basically your motherboard with wi-fi), the only BIOS which runs fine and doesn't crash or cause weird issues like restart not posting, is the very first version they released.

Have you done a BIOS update? What BIOS version do you have? You can find this by searching "system information" and running the app, it will be like F1 or F2b etc.
